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

slocun

não consigo ligaçao com a BD!

Recommended Posts

Boas!

 

não consigo ligaçao com a BD! estou a trabalhar em ASP e a BD é em access, não consigo fazer a ligaçao ODBC com o access. da o seguinte erro:

 

Falha no processo de configuração.

 

se alguem souber o que se passa eu agradeço explicação :rolleyes:

 

tenho um código que introduzi no web developer que não sei se está correcto porque o erro que me tem dado é sempre para a ligação à base de dados.

 

ponto de situação:

 

<%@ Page Language="VB" aspcompat=true Debug="true" AutoEventWireup="false" CodeFile="Default.aspx.vb" Inherits="_Default" %>

<configuration>

<system.web>

<compilation debug="true"/>

</system.web>

</configuration>

<html>

<head>

<title>Tabela</title>

</head>

<body>

<form id="form1" runat="server">

<h1><div align="center">Leitura da tabela</div></h1>

<br>

<br>

<% Dim conn, sSQL, RS

conn = Server.CreateObject("ADODB.Connection")

conn.open("driver={Microsoft Access Driver (GestrofaBD.mdb)};DBQ=" & Server.MapPath("C:\Documents and Settings\estagio\Os meus documentos\Visual Studio 2008\WebSite1\GestrofaBD.mdb"))

sSQL = "select * from Cadastro cliente order by nome"

RS = conn.execute(sSQL)

%>

<table align="center">

<tr>

<th>Nome</th>

<th>Telefone</th>

</tr>

<%

Do While Not RS

%>

<tr>

<td><%=RS("nome")%></td>

<td><%=RS("telefone")%></td>

</tr>

<% RS.movenext()

Loop

conn.close()%>

</table>

<div align="center">

<a href="inserir.html">acrescenter novo registo</a><br>

<a href="actualizar.asp">Actualizar um registo existente</a><br>

<a href="apagar.asp">apagar um registo</a><br></div>

<asp:Image ID="Image1" runat="server" Height="123px" Width="126px"

ImageUrl="~/gestrofa 2.bmp" />

</form>

</body>

</html>

-----------------------------------------

 

agradeço toda a ajuda que me possam dar http://forum.imasters.com.br/public/style_emoticons/default/grin.gif

 

cumpz http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

Compartilhar este post


Link para o post
Compartilhar em outros sites

você esta mexendo com asp ou asp.net?

Porque contem algumas linhas do asp.net e com ele eh bem mais fácil conectar ao bd.

 

sim estou a trabalhar em asp.net!

Sabe como conectar com a bd apartir do asp.net?

 

obrigado.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Movido de Plataforma.Net http://forum.imasters.com.br/public/style_emoticons/default/seta.gif Plataforma.Net // Web Applications

 

Abrindo Conexão:

Imports System.Data.OleDb

Dim objConn As OleDbConnection
Dim strCaminho As String = Server.MapPath("/caminho/banco.mdb")
objConn = New O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& strCaminho & ";")
objConn.Open()

Fechando a Conexão:

objConn.Close()
objConn.Dispose()

Abraços...

Compartilhar este post


Link para o post
Compartilhar em outros sites

Existem duas formas.

A primeira e mais fácil é usando o objeto "AccessDataSource" da palheta "Toolbox". Você arrasta para a tela de trabalho, clica em "ConfigureDataSource" e vai abrir uma janela Wizard, ai é so segui os passos.

 

A segunda forma é um pouco mais complicada perto da primeira, mas é sussa também. De uma olhada.

Access

 

Estou um pouco sem tempo agora, mas a noite se precisar posso lhe ajudando.

Abraço.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Existem duas formas.

A primeira e mais fácil é usando o objeto "AccessDataSource" da palheta "Toolbox". Você arrasta para a tela de trabalho, clica em "ConfigureDataSource" e vai abrir uma janela Wizard, ai é so segui os passos.

 

A segunda forma é um pouco mais complicada perto da primeira, mas é sussa também. De uma olhada.

Access

 

Estou um pouco sem tempo agora, mas a noite se precisar posso lhe ajudando.

Abraço.

Agradeço muito a sua ajuda.

Assim que puder vou verificar se consigo a ligação à BD! é que eu ando a estagiar e so nessa hora é que eu posso testar.

hoje talvez ja não possa testar nada mas amanha com certeza irei faze-lo!

Caso tenha alguma duvida venho aki posta-la!

obrigado por toda a ajuda! esta a ser muito util.

cumpz http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.